Water pooling prevention services focus on identifying and addressing areas around a property where excess water tends to collect after rainfall or irrigation. These services typically involve assessing the landscape, grading, and drainage systems to determine the causes of water accumulation. Professionals may recommend solutions such as regrading the terrain to promote proper runoff, installing or repairing drainage systems like French drains or surface drains, and sealing low spots that trap water. The goal is to create a landscape that directs water away from foundations, walkways, and other vulnerable areas, helping to maintain the property's integrity and appearance.
This service helps resolve common problems associated with water pooling, including soil erosion, foundation damage, basement flooding, and landscaping issues. Standing water can lead to long-term structural concerns and create conditions conducive to mold and mildew growth. Proper drainage and grading prevent water from seeping into basements or crawl spaces, reducing the risk of costly repairs. Additionally, effective water management minimizes the formation of muddy or uneven patches in lawns and gardens, maintaining the property’s visual appeal and safety.

The overview below groups typical Water Pooling Prevention proj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Chesterfield County, VA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Inspection and Assessment Costs - Typically, a professional assessment of water pooling issues ranges from $150 to $400. This includes site evaluation and recommendations for prevention measures. Costs may vary based on property size and complexity.
Drainage System Installation - Installing drainage solutions such as French drains or surface grading can cost between $2,000 and $6,000. The price depends on the scope of work and the extent of the affected area.
Surface Grading and Landscaping - Proper grading and landscaping to prevent pooling generally range from $1,500 to $4,500. This includes soil adjustments and minor landscaping modifications to direct water away from structures.
Maintenance and Repair Services - Ongoing maintenance or repairs for water pooling issues usually cost between $100 and $500 per visit. These services ensure drainage systems remain effective over time.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water pooling around a property? Water pooling can result from poor drainage, compacted soil, or improper grading that prevents water from flowing away effectively.
How can water pooling damage a property? Standing water may lead to foundation issues, soil erosion, and increased risk of pests, potentially causing long-term structural and property damage.
What services are available to prevent water pooling? Local service providers offer drainage solutions, grading adjustments, and installation of drainage systems to help prevent water accumulation.
How do drainage systems help prevent pooling? Drainage systems direct excess water away from the property, reducing the likelihood of standing water and related damage.
